Default Looking for a charger

My trusty Turnigy 6S died last weekend so now I'm looking for something different. I run nitro so this will mostly be charging small LiFe rx packs and NiMH transmitter packs. My kids have slashes so we occasionally charge 2S LIPO's up to 5000mah.

Ideally I would like to parallel charge their batteries so I want something that can do 8 to 10 amps at 8.4 volts. I would prefer an AC charger so I have one less thing to worry about at the track. I've narrowed my choices down to the Racers Edge SureCharge 2010 (8 amps but voltage not specified), the Onyx 235 (8 amps but only 50 watts), or the iCharger 206b (a bit more expensive once you add the power supply and perhaps questionable quality - look at the junsi 1000w failure rates lately).

Any thoughts from the community?
